Vidan Design previews Billund Airport for MSFS

 

Vidan Design is a scenery developer focusing on Denmark. One of their most popular sceneries is Billund Airport (EKBI). This scenery has been previously developed for Prepar3D. They are now converting it to Microsoft Flight Simulator. The first screenshots were posted today on the Facebook page.

Billund Airport is located on the Danish mainland. It’s one of the busiest air cargo centres in the country, as well as a popular charter destination for many airlines. It gets many daily flights to the biggest cities in Europe. Paris, Frankfurt, Istanbul, Amsterdam and London are just a selection of them. Besides Billund, it also serves Legoland Billund, the second largest tourist attraction in Denmark.

We don’t know what features this airport will have yet. There’s also no info about the release. Once there is, we will let you know. For now, you can enjoy the screenshots posted below.
